摘要 |
A method for improving distributed resource allocation in OFDMA based wireless communication networks such as WiMAX IEEE 802.16 for either fixed or mobile subscriber stations SSs is executed by neighbor Base Stations BSs serving the SSs. Each BS controls the allocation of respective permutation zones and radio resources encompassing different radio subchannels within each permutation zone. In this task the BS avails of RRM primitives and instances of a NCMS functionality promoting direct BS-to-BS communication, which can be exploited in a distributed RRM profile. A BS playing the role of RRC sends to Neighbor BSs a unique RRM Request for receiving event-driven Spare Capacity Reports. Among driving events, Change of Radio Resources Allocation is included. Neighbor BSs, at every allocation change is detected, send to the requester BS a Spare Capacity Report including a Bitmap indicating subchannels used for transmission in each Permutation Zone. In order to eliminate Co-Channel Interference CCI, the requester BS avoids using same subchannels already indicated in the received Bitmap. |
